Job Description

 

The Role

  • The Analytics Head leads MSI Nigeria’s data analytics and reporting function, ensuring that high-quality, timely, and decision-relevant insights are available to programme, clinical, and organisational leadership.
  • The role sets the analytical agenda for the department, governs reporting standards, and builds the organisation’s internal data literacy and analytical capability.
  • The Analytics Head works closely with Programmes, Operations, M&E, MEL, Research, and Clinical Services teams, and ensures that analytical outputs from all decision-support systems are fit for purpose, accurate, and strategically meaningful.

Key Responsibilities
Analytics Strategy & Leadership:

  • Develop and drive the analytics strategy for MSI Nigeria, ensuring analytical capabilities align with programmatic and operational decision-making needs.
  • Set quality standards for all analytical outputs including dashboards, reports, datasets, and ad hoc analyses.
  • Oversee the organisation’s reporting infrastructure, including Power BI, Excel, MIS-Sun Reporting, and other business intelligence platforms.
  • Identify and champion opportunities to strengthen data use culture across MSI Nigeria through training, advocacy, and modelling good practice.
  • Contribute to the department’s strategic planning and represent the analytics function at departmental and SMT levels as required.
  • Support the resource mobilisation team with accurate and timely analytics and data modelling to support all proposals and fund raising efforts.

Data Analysis & Reporting:

  • Ensure the timely production of all scheduled programme and operational reports to internal and external audiences.
  • Oversee the design and maintenance of analytical dashboards and data visualisations that support leadership decision-making.
  • Ensure analytical outputs are clearly communicated, well-documented, and accessible to both technical and non-technical audiences.
  • Lead the analysis of complex, multi-source datasets to generate programme insights, including family planning metrics, service delivery trends, and outcome indicators.
  • Respond to ad hoc analytical requests from the Country Director, SMT, and programme leads in a timely and accurate manner.

MIS & Programme Data Oversight:

  • Ensure the integrity, completeness, and timeliness of data flowing from field data collection tools into reporting systems.
  • Liaise with the M&E, MEL, and Research teams to align analytical outputs with monitoring frameworks and programme indicators.
  • Identify data quality issues across MIS and reporting pipelines and coordinate with the Business Solutions Manager to address root causes.
  • Support clinical governance and service delivery channels reporting requirements by ensuring relevant data pipelines are maintained and accurate.
  • Oversee the management and continuous improvement of MIS reporting tools used by programme and clinical teams.

Data Governance & Quality:

  • Establish and maintain analytical standards, naming conventions, and data dictionary documentation for all key datasets and reports.
  • Review all major analytical outputs before external submission or senior presentation for accuracy, consistency, and interpretive integrity.
  • Ensure compliance with MSI data protection policies and responsible data principles in all analytical work.
  • Develop and maintain a version control and change management process for all production dashboards and reports.
  • Support the Head of Department in identifying and reporting on organisational data risks.

Data Privacy Governance:

  • Serve as MSI Nigeria's internal Data Privacy focal point, coordinating with information leads across all departments to ensure consistent adherence to data privacy standards.
  • Maintain and regularly review MSI Nigeria's data privacy policies, ensuring alignment with the Nigeria Data Protection Regulation (NDPR) and any applicable MSI global standards.
  • Monitor changes in Nigerian and international data privacy legislation and advise the Head of Department and SMT on implications for MSI Nigeria's operations.

Privacy Impact Assessments:

  • Conduct Privacy Impact Assessments (PIAs) for all new and significantly changed data systems, research activities, and programme data collection processes.
  • Document identified privacy risks with clear mitigation plans, owners, and review timelines, maintaining a live risk register for sign-off by the Head of Department.
  • Ensure PIA outputs are factored into system design and procurement decisions, including the ERP implementation.

Training & Awareness:

  • Design and deliver regular data privacy training for all MSI Nigeria staff, ensuring content is role-appropriate, engaging, and up to date with current legal requirements.
  • Maintain a data privacy training register, tracking completion rates across all departments and escalating gaps to department heads and HR.
  • Develop and circulate periodic data privacy awareness communications to reinforce a culture of responsible data handling across the organisation.

Incident & Compliance Oversight:

  • Serve as the first point of escalation for data privacy incidents or concerns raised by staff or information leads in other departments.
  • Document any data privacy incidents, assess their severity, and coordinate the organisational response in line with NDPR requirements and MSI policy.
  • Produce a quarterly data privacy compliance summary for the Head of Department covering training status, PIAs completed, risks identified, and incidents handled.

Team Leadership & Capability Building:

  • Directly line-manage the Senior Data Analyst and Analyst, setting objectives, reviewing performance, and building analytical capability.
  • Design and deliver structured learning opportunities for staff across MSI Nigeria to improve their data literacy and use of analytical tools.
  • Foster a team culture of rigour, curiosity, and continuous improvement in analytical standards.
  • Manage workload planning across the analytics team, ensuring sustainable distribution of tasks and appropriate prioritisation.
  • Identify capability gaps in the team and make recommendations for recruitment, training, or role adjustment.

Key Experience/Qualification

  • Bachelor’s degree in Statistics, Data Science, Epidemiology, Information Systems, Public Health, or a closely related quantitative field.
  • A postgraduate qualification in a relevant discipline is an advantage
  • Minimum 7 years’ experience in data analysis, MIS, or business intelligence roles, with at least 3 years in a leadership or senior capacity.
  • Demonstrated experience leading and managing an analytics or data team.
  • Proven experience designing and delivering analytical outputs for strategic decision-making in a complex organisational context.
  • Experience working with M&E or programme data in a global health, development, or humanitarian setting.
  • Demonstrated proficiency with Power BI or equivalent business intelligence tools.
  • Experience with DHIS2 or similar programme reporting platforms is a strong advantage
  • Working knowledge of the Nigeria Data Protection Regulation (NDPR) and its operational implications for an NGO context.
  • Demonstrable understanding of privacy impact assessment methodology

Essential Skills & Competencies:

  • Advanced analytical skills, including the ability to work with large, complex, and multi-source datasets.
  • Strong proficiency in Power BI, including DAX, data modelling, and report design.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including the ability to present complex findings clearly to non-technical audiences.
  • Strong understanding of M&E frameworks, programme indicators, and results reporting.
  • Effective people management and coaching skills.
  • Strong documentation discipline for risk registers, training records, and incident logs.
  • Ability to design and deliver engaging compliance training for diverse, non-technical audiences.
  • Meticulous attention to data quality, accuracy, and interpretive integrity.

Desirable:

  • Familiarity with family planning programme indicators, including CYP, mCPR, and PPFP.
  • Experience with field data collection platforms such as ODK, ONA, or CommCare.
  • Knowledge of Power Query M, SQL, or Python for data transformation
  • Experience with clinical or health systems data in an NGO or health facility context.
